Course Content

• Foundations of Mathematical Logic
• Set Theory and its Axioms (Zermelo-Fraenkel)
• Proof Techniques and Mathematical Completeness
• Gödel's Incompleteness Theorems
• Model Theory and its Applications
• Computability Theory and Turing Machines
• Axiomatic Set Theory and Consistency
• Advanced Topics in Mathematical Logic
